A MULTIDISCIPLINARY PLATFORM FOR CHANGE

What is changing in scientific research and in the technologies used to treat blood cancers?
What barriers still remain in everyday care, in the organization of healthcare services, and in patients’ quality of life?
And, above all, what truly matters to those living with the disease?

BLOOD CANCER SUMMIT was created to address these questions with an integrated and courageous outlook.
By combining science, innovation, and human storytelling, the Summit gives voice to the key actors in care: researchers, clinicians, patients, caregivers, institutions, and artists.

Because talking about blood cancers today means talking about the future – and about hope as a shared choice, a collective responsibility, and a concrete opportunity for transformation.

BLOOD CANCER SUMMIT serves as a platform for dialogue among physicians and researchers, institutions and healthcare managers, industry representatives and patients.
It aims to connect experts and testimonials in a multidisciplinary, inclusive, participatory, and creative environment.

The Summit is an annual event entirely dedicated to the world of blood cancers, with the goal to:

  • Share the latest advances in scientific and clinical research
  • Highlight the still unresolved challenges in hospital and community care
  • Foster connections between research, unmet medical needs, and patients’ quality of life
  • Give genuine space to the voice and experience of those living with a blood cancer

THE FORMAT - Evolving, Itinerant, Transformative

BLOOD CANCER SUMMIT is designed as an event that is:

  • Annual and itinerant: held each year in a different city, often in collaboration with national and international centers of excellence;
  • Modular: combining technical-scientific sessions, multidisciplinary discussions, and immersive artistic experiences;
  • Transformative: each edition concludes with a roadmap of progress, featuring measurable indicators to be monitored until the following year.



THE PROTAGONISTS - An ecosystem of dialogue and co-design

BLOOD CANCER SUMMIT brings together all the voices actively engaged in the fight against blood cancers:

  • Patients and caregivers
  • Researchers, physicians, nurses, pharmacists
  • Policymakers and healthcare institutions
  • Pharmaceutical and biotech companies
  • The scientific and academic community
  • Journalists, communicators, artists, and activists

This multistakeholder approach ensures a plurality of perspectives, shared languages, and the co-design of sustainable solutions.

ART & CARE - Art as the distinctive feature of the Blood Cancer Summit

BLOOD CANCER SUMMIT is unique

In a context dominated by numbers, protocols, and metrics, art restores voice, body, and emotion to the human experience of illness.
It is not a mere accessory but a structural dimension of the Summit – conceived to translate into a universl language what scientific words alone cannot express.

Blood cancers affect not only the body, but also the relationship with oneself, with time, and with others.

Art captures that grey area between diagnosis and lived experience, between medical knowledge and emotional depth.

Within this perspective, the photographic exhibition “IO SONO QUI” (“I AM HERE”) and the the short film “QUI ORA” (“HERE NOW”) are not side elements but instruments of exploration, care, and communication.

The artistic component is based on authentic interviews with patients and caregivers, which serve as the emotional and narrative foundation for:

  • Performative dance: choreographies expressing deep emotions – fear, anger, confusion, resilience, rebirth;
  • Photo exhibition: intense portraits accompanied by quotes, reflections, and brief texts drawn from interviews.

These artistic creations trace a journey that begins with pain and disorientation and leads – through science and clinical progress – to a message of hope and transformation.

A holistic and transformative approach. 

Art transcends traditional boundaries between medicine, psychology, communication, and culture, becoming:

  • a therapeutic tool for participants,
  • a vehicle of awareness for observers,
  • a catalyst of empathy for decision-makers and communicators.

Each edition of the Summit, as an experiential event, generates new artistic content to be integrated into educational, cultural, and institutional initiatives.
